CORNER DEFENSE
Corner Defense System
The Corner Defense is a strategy based on balanced table coverage. Unlike other methods that aim for big wins by betting on single numbers, this system sacrifices high payouts in favor of more frequent wins. The idea is to bet on corners (four numbers per chip) and areas surrounding a target number, thus reducing risk and increasing coverage.
This system is ideal for players who prefer a more stable progression and lower variation in losses and gains.
Example 1: Corner Defense with 5 Chips
Bet on a specific number (e.g., 26) and its four adjacent corners. This covers a total of 9 numbers.
- If 22, 24, 28, or 30 comes up: → Profit of 4 chips
- If 23, 25, 27, or 29 comes up: → Profit of 13 chips
- If 26 comes up: → Profit of 67 chips
Example 2: Corner Defense with 9 Chips
Bet on number 26, its corners, and the 4 side numbers surrounding it — increasing coverage while keeping the same target.
- If 22, 24, 28, or 30 comes up: → No profit (partial recovery)
- If 23, 25, 27, or 29 comes up: → Profit of 27 chips
- If 26 comes up: → Profit of 135 chips
Example 3: Corner Defense with 10 Chips
Bet on two nearby numbers (e.g., 20 and 26) and their adjacent corners. This setup covers up to 15 numbers.
- If 16, 18, 28, or 30 comes up: → Loss of 1 chip
- If 17, 19, 21, 22, 24, 25, 27, or 29 comes up: → Profit of 6 chips
- If 23 comes up: → Profit of 26 chips
- If 20 or 26 comes up: → Profit of 67 chips
Example 4: Split Defense with 10 Chips
This structure is similar to the previous example but distributes chips to cover 18 numbers (almost half the table). It’s a more balanced version with lower gains but also lower risk.
- If 16, 18, 22, 24, 25, 27, 31, or 33 comes up: → Loss of 1 chip
- If 17, 19, 21, 23, 26, 28, 30, or 32 comes up: → Profit of 6 chips
- If 20 or 29 comes up: → Profit of 67 chips
Final Considerations
The Corner Defense is a solid strategy to cover large areas of the board with moderate investment. It’s ideal for players who prefer a more stable game with lower volatility.
It is essential to maintain a consistent proportion when increasing your bets. If you choose to raise the number of chips, distribute them proportionally to your previous bet. Breaking that proportion may destabilize the system.
